Opus Capital Group LLC Purchases 253 Shares of Exxon Mobil Corporation $XOM

Opus Capital Group LLC boosted its position in Exxon Mobil Corporation (NYSE:XOMFree Report) by 3.4% during the second qu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The fund owned 7,615 shares of the oil and gas company’s stock after acquiring an additional 253 shares during the period. Opus Capital Group LLC’s holdings in Exxon Mobil were worth $821,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

About Exxon Mobil

Exxon Mobil Corporation engages in the exploration and production of crude oil and natural gas in the United States and internationally. It operates through Upstream, Energy Products, Chemical Products, and Specialty Products segments. The Upstream segment explores for and produces crude oil and natural gas.
